x^3y^3 + 343
The way the sum of cubes works is by taking the roots of each term and applying the formula.
The sum of cubes is as follows:
a^3 + b^3 = (a + b)(a^2 - ab + b^2)
In this case, we would display it like this:
x^3y^3 + 343 = (xy + 7)(x^2y^2 - 7xy + 49)
